Title of article :
Effect of Cu addition on the martensitic transformation of powder metallurgy processed Ti–Ni alloys

Abstract :
Ti50Ni50 and Ti50Ni30Cu20 powders were prepared by gas atomization and their transformation behaviors were examined by means of differential scanning calorimetry and X-ray diffraction. One-step B2–B19’ transformation occurred in Ti50Ni50 powders, while Ti50Ni30Cu20 powders showed B2–B19 transformation behavior. Porous bulks with 24% porosity were fabricated by spark plasma sintering. The martensitic transformation start temperature (50 °C) of Ti50Ni50 porous bulk is much higher than that (22 °C) of the as-solidified powders. However, the martensitic transformation start temperature (35 °C) of Ti50Ni30Cu20 porous bulk is almost the same as that (33 °C) of the powders. When the specimens were compressed to the strain of 8% and then unloaded, the residual strains of Ti50Ni50 and Ti50Ni30Cu20 alloy bulks were 3.95 and 3.7%, respectively. However, these residual strains were recovered up to 1.7% after heating by the shape memory phenomenon.
